    Other than a security guy, one of 3 dudes may be there on any given day. One dude looks like Ray…read moreRomano. Another looks like Jack Nicholson. The last dude might resemble one of the Jonas Brothers. But what gives this place 5 stars, is the ice cream. Diridon has the widest selection of unusual ice cream in the whole downtown area: more than any other quickie mart, more than any downtown grocery store, and unbelievably, even more than any downtown ice cream store. If you need proof, look at these photos from yesterday. And there was a LOT more there than the what the pictures showed. The Tin Roof Sundae and Green Tea ice creams from the TREAT company were missing this time, but I got some 1020 to substitute. Once upon a time when cavemen roamed the earth, some grocery stores would have many of these wacky flavors on their shelves. But today's grocery stores often say that they have the widest selection of ice cream - but by mostly giving you endless brand variations of strawberry, vanilla, or chocolate ice cream. 1/13/23: Edited to add: I forgot to mention one more thing that sets this store apart from the other stores in downtown: Almost every item is labeled with the price, And almost every item is computer scanned by the cashier. If you have shopped at many of the other convenience stores downtown, you often don't know how much something costs until you take it to the cash register - and because the cashier does not check any price lists when ringing you up, have you noticed that it can seem like the prices you pay for the same items will go up and down depending on who is at the cash register, and how well you are dressed? That does not happen here, because the prices are all marked next to the products, and already in the system. So, 5 star review for Diridon Market.
